The product's functionality centres on bamboo charcoal's ability to adsorb airborne molecules, including formaldehyde and various odour compounds. The sewing style pouch construction keeps charcoal contained while the fabric permits necessary air circulation. This design balances containment with accessibility to the charcoal's surface area.
Material and Build
The primary functional material is bamboo charcoal, a form of activated carbon known for its porous structure that traps airborne particles and gases. The charcoal is contained within a textile pouch described as "sewing style," suggesting a sewn fabric enclosure rather than a disposable plastic container. This construction allows the bags to be placed discretely in various settings without industrial appearance. Everyday Home Use
For regular household air quality maintenance, the bags offer placement flexibility in problem odour areas: inside shoe cupboards, litter tray areas, kitchen bins, or musty wardrobes. Their non-electrical nature makes them safe for damp environments like bathrooms (though not in direct water contact) or confined spaces like car footwells. The charcoal's adsorption capacity naturally diminishes over time, but sunlight exposure can help release moisture and partially refresh performance, extending useful life without consumable replacements.
